Output 1506510e6a19c2699a003e70446dde89fe87fb98dcca00520acc4bd14e865e6e: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9178c45ed23b59da29e88e57606539a45f0428a3 OP_EQUAL
address
3ExCaQJ13j98WQemSr4s42nCsLDv4RuCdY
transaction
1506510e6a19c2699a003e70446dde89fe87fb98dcca00520acc4bd14e865e6e
spent
true